Gaighata Population - Paschim Medinipur, West Bengal

Gaighata is a medium size village located in Kharagpur - I Block of Paschim Medinipur district, West Bengal with total 95 families residing. The Gaighata village has population of 360 of which 187 are males while 173 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Gaighata village population of children with age 0-6 is 32 which makes up 8.89 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Gaighata village is 925 which is lower than West Bengal state average of 950. Child Sex Ratio for the Gaighata as per census is 1133, higher than West Bengal average of 956.

Gaighata village has higher literacy rate compared to West Bengal. In 2011, literacy rate of Gaighata village was 90.24 % compared to 76.26 % of West Bengal. In Gaighata Male literacy stands at 91.86 % while female literacy rate was 88.46 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 23.06 % of total population in Gaighata village. The village Gaighata currently doesn’t have any Schedule Tribe (ST) population.

Work Profile

In Gaighata village out of total population, 127 were engaged in work activities. 14.96 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 85.04 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 127 workers engaged in Main Work, 1 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 0 were Agricultural labourer.
